An apple shaped moth, I think Phonetic: "Ape-eth" - Lancashire, and derogatory, turn of phrase meaning clumsy and lumbering male of below average intelligence. Usually employed by wives when husbands are in the way; "Get out of the way, you great daft appoth!". Can be spelt any way you like though. _____________________
